Hutchinson Square in Douglas has recently been renovated and the gates on the eastern side removed. The wartime history is displayed in several places. What is lacking? A common observation of mine is that the open spaces lack children playing. Marie and I walked around upper Douglas for about an hour late this morning without seeing a single child or young person on foot. Sure there are a lot people engaged in organised sport and there are good reasons for not allowing children of certain ages to go out alone but surely there should be some out and about, especially on a beautiful morning when the forecast for the afternoon was not good.. There are plenty of things I would avoid if I had my life again but childhood play is not one of them.
